This is my bill of materials for a home lab server build
Plan is to run Proxmox Hypervisor and OKD lab.
Please can some one have a look.

[BOM]

1	CPU	        | AMD EPYC 7352 24 Core 155W Server Processor	| 1
2	Motherboard | SUPERMICRO MBD-H12DSi-N6 Extended ATX Server Motherboard Socket SP3 | 1	
3	Memory	        | Micron 32GB (1x32GB), PC4-25600 (3200MHz) ECC Reg DDR4 Server DRAM X4 | 4
4	Storage	        | Crucial P3 Plus 2TB M.2 2280 NVMe PCIe 4.0 SSD | 1
5	Storage	        | Seagate BarraCuda 4TB 3.5in SATA HDD | 1
6	Cooler CPU	| Noctua NH-U14S TR4-SP3 CPU Cooler | 1
7	Case	        | Fractal Design Torrent Solid E-ATX Mid-Tower Case | 1
8	Power             | Corsair RM1000e 1000W Power Supply | 1

[Cost]
This is a 24 core cpu build with a price tag of around USD 2500. Wanting a bit more head room on the CPU front.

[Concern]
My main concern is that budget is a bit too high.
I am not sure if I should downgrade to a consumer grade 16 core Intel i9 or 16 core AMD Ryzen build.
